Revolutionizing Player Security: Innovations and Challenges
In a landscape where data breaches and fraudulent activities threaten industry integrity, operators are investing heavily in advanced security protocols. Multi-factor authentication (MFA), end-to-end encryption, and biometric verification have become industry standards, yet emerging solutions are continually reshaping the security paradigm.
For instance, decentralized verification methods leveraging blockchain technology aim to eliminate common vulnerabilities in traditional systems. These approaches provide transparent, tamper-proof records of transactions and identity verification, significantly reducing fraud and identity theft concerns (Gaming Industry Journal, 2023). As these innovations become more prevalent, operators who adopt cutting-edge security measures gain a competitive edge by prioritizing player safety.
The Role of Certification and Licensing in Building Trust
Beyond technical security measures, regulatory bodies and licensing authorities play a fundamental role in establishing credibility. Random Number Generator (RNG) certification, financial audit transparency, and adherence to responsible gaming policies are critical indicators of legitimacy. Operators featured on respected licensing jurisdictions, such as Gibraltar, Malta, or the UK, are often perceived as more trustworthy by players.
| Certification | Jurisdiction | Key Assurance | Reputation |
|---|---|---|---|
| eCOGRA | UK | Fair gaming, payout transparency | Highly Recognized |
| GLI | Global | Technical testing, RNG validation | International Trust |
| iTech Labs | Australia | Game fairness, RNG testing | Respected |
Player Confidence and Transparency: The Industry’s Next Frontier
Transparency initiatives, such as real-time payout data, player reviews, and public audits, are becoming integral to safeguarding player confidence. Many licensed operators now offer comprehensive responsible gaming tools, including self-exclusion and deposit limits, reinforcing their commitment to player welfare.
Additionally, blockchain integration and open ledger systems allow players to verify fairness independently, creating a more participatory environment that enhances trust.
